Good Morning Delmarva discusses the potential closing of the Shepherd’s Place

WMDT – The Shepherd Place, a shelter in the Dover area is set to close soon.

This morning, Tasha Scott, the executive director, is here to tell us why this organization is so important to the community.

We’re told the shelter was opened in 1990 to provide support for full families and single women.

It’s been a pillar for the Kent County community as there aren’t many shelters in the state of Delaware.

Scott says that it’s a devastating situation as it will be winter soon and their residents will have nowhere else to go.

They are trying to raise awareness by hosting a community event on Saturday, November 16th at 10 a.m.
